AMI-MG1. UGL507.AM0004. About the designer: Born in 1980, Alexandre Mattiussi studied at Duperré fashion design school in Paris, specializing in menswear design. Formerly working for Dior, Givenchy, Marc Jacobs, Mattiussi wanted to do a collection that he could really afford and wear. The designer launched his own brand in 2011: AMI. The brandâs name is composed of his initials and the last letter of his name, translated meaning âfriendâ. It is a proposition of real clothes for a real manâ, explains the Mattiussi. Ami is positioned at an affordable price point while offering high quality and sophisticated designs.
